HTML!DOCTYPE标签布局引用的几种方法行级元素与块级元素

HTML!DOCTYPE标签布局引用的几种方法行级元素与块级元素


2024年5月4日发(作者:)

HTML!DOCTYPE标签布局引用的几种方法行级元素与块级

元素

1. HTML5 DOCTYPE:

HTML5是当前主流的HTML版本,使用HTML5DOCTYPE可以确保浏览器

以HTML5的规范解析页面。这种方法不需要引用DTD(文档类型定义),

因为HTML5不再依赖DTD。

这种方法定义了HTML4.01的DTD,通过引用DTD来指定HTML的规范。

HTML4.01 DOCTYPE包括三种类型:Strict(严格模式)、Transitional

(过渡模式)和Frameset(框架模式)。

XHTML是一种基于XML的HTML版本,使用XHTML1.0 DOCTYPE可以确

保浏览器以XHTML1.0的规范解析页面。XHTML1.0 DOCTYPE也包括三种类

型:Strict、Transitional和Frameset。

行级元素是指在文本流中水平排列的元素,它们不会独占一行,并且

不能设置宽度和高度。一些常见的行级元素包括:span、a、strong、em、

img等。行级元素可以在一行中显示,并且可以和其他行级元素共享一行。

块级元素是指独占一行的元素,它们会自动换行,并且可以设置宽度

和高度。一些常见的块级元素包括:p、div、h1-h6、ul、ol、li等。块

级元素会从新的一行开始显示,并且通常会有一定的外边距和内边距。

HTML中行级元素和块级元素的区别体现在以下几个方面:

1.显示方式:行级元素在一行中显示,从左到右排列,而块级元素独

占一行,从上到下排列。

2.宽度和高度:行级元素不能设置宽度和高度,它们的宽度和高度由

内容决定;而块级元素可以设置宽度和高度。

3.盒模型:行级元素的外边距和内边距不会影响其他元素的布局,而

块级元素的外边距和内边距会影响其他元素的布局。

4. 默认属性:行级元素的默认display属性通常为inline,而块级

元素的默认display属性通常为block。

总结:


发布者:admin,转转请注明出处:http://www.yc00.com/web/1714801291a2518471.html

相关推荐

发表回复

评论列表(0条)

  • 暂无评论

联系我们

400-800-8888

在线咨询: QQ交谈

邮件:admin@example.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信